Shillingford St George
Shillingford St. George is a village on the outskirts of Exeter, Teignbridge, England. It is about 3 miles south of the City of Exeter. At the 2021 census, the village had a population of 395.Photo: David Smith, CC BY-SA 2.0.

Alphington
Suburb
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
Alphington is a former manor and village, now a suburb of the City of Exeter in Devon. The ward of Alphington has a population of 8,250 according to the 2001 census, making it the third largest in Exeter, with the village itself accounting for about a quarter of this figure. Alphington is situated 1½ miles northeast of Shillingford St George.
Ide
Village
Photo: David Smith,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Ide is a village in Devon, England, just under 1 mile southwest of Exeter. The village church is dedicated to the German Saint Ida of Herzfeld and was rebuilt in 1834. Ide is situated 1½ miles north of Shillingford St George.
Cowick
Neighborhood
Photo: Sarah Charlesworth,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Cowick is a suburb of the City of Exeter in Devon. Historically it was a manor situated in the parish of St Thomas, Exeter, within the hundred of Wonford. It was formerly the site of a Benedictine monastery. Cowick is situated 2 miles north of Shillingford St George.
